#590c0b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#590c0b is composed of 34.9% red, 4.7% green and 4.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 86.5% magenta, 87.6% yellow and 65.1% black. It has a hue angle of 0.8 degrees, a saturation of 78% and a lightness of 19.6%. #590c0b color hex could be obtained by blending #b21816 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660000.

● #590c0b color description : Very dark red.
#590c0b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#590c0b has RGB values of R:89, G:12, B:11 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.87, Y:0.88, K:0.65. Its decimal value is 5835787.

Shades and Tints of #590c0b
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020000 is the darkest color, while #fdefef is the lightest one.

Tones of #590c0b
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#333131 is the less saturated color, while #610503 is the most saturated one.
